About this listen

Tyrone and Grandad Cleveland are off on a new adventure, this time to the barbershop. Tyrone's Cool Crown is the second fun-filled imaginative tale from award-winning comedian and actor, Lenny Henry.

Tyrone loves his hair and all the cool shapes he can make with it. No clippers are coming anywhere near him! But after an afternoon diving through the leaves in the park, Grandad Cleveland and Mum think it's time for a trip to the barbers. Tyrone does not want to go! But once he's sat in the chair in Dalisa's grooving salon, and after some history and comforting words from Grandad, Tyrone feels like a king!

A joyful celebration of hair, told through a highly entertaining rhyming story and brilliantly brought to life by illustrator Salomey Doku.
